Topic: Define and discuss the rise of two of the new approaches to the theory of law; feminism and postmodernism. What effects upon the legal system are these two approaches likely to have? To fully discuss the effect of feminism and postmodernism upon the legal system we must define each theory as it stands in relation to the law. Feminism can be best explained as "the support for the social equality of the sexes, leading to opposition to patriarchy (social organisation in which males dominate females) and sexism."1 In concept and procedure feminism is highly variable. Those who see themselves as feminists advocate differing levels of criticisms of patriarchy and advance according alternatives to the status quo.
